Y Combinator-incubated LendUp launched in October with supporting from Kleiner Perkins, Andreessen Horowitz, Bing Ventures, Kapor Capital among others, to carry a fresh treatment for a vintage issue: you must spend your bills now, but you don’t have the cash to cover them. As opposed to move to predatory lenders and banking institutions, with regards to high interest levels, borrow cash from buddies or protect your eyes and hope they’re going away, what now ??
It may look like a predicament that only befalls the chronically reckless, however in reality, 15 million Us americans looked to payday loan providers to borrow cash year that is last. In place of finding yourself saddled with long-lasting financial obligation from concealed fees or wrestling with Draconian terms and expensive rollovers, LendUp would like to provide those hunting for a speedy fix up to a short-term monetary conundrum ways to borrow cash without hidden charges, costly rollovers and high-interest prices.
The lending room in particular has started to brim with startups — like BillFloat, Zest, Think Finance, Kabbage
On Deck and Lending Club — each of that will be trying to allow it to be easier for customers and businesses that are small obtain access to money and never have to leap via a million hoops. LendUp, in comparison, is positioning it self as being a direct loan provider, utilizing technology and Big Data to permit customers with bad or no credit to obtain usage of small-dollar, short-term loans (as much as $250 for thirty days) and build their credit while doing this.
Unfortuitously, many credit reporting agencies turn their backs on pay day loans, so just because folks are in a position to pay them on time, it does not assist their credit ratings as well as the period of bad credit keeps on rotating. Most banks won’t touch these form of loans because they’re high-risk, but like On Deck Capital (which will be trying to streamline the financing procedure for small enterprises), LendUp makes use of Big Data to accomplish risk that is instant and assess creditworthiness, weeding out those individuals who have bad credit for a explanation from those that might have become victims for the system.
Along side eschewing concealed charges, rollovers and interest that is high, LendUp streamlines the applying procedure for loans — which traditionally takes forever — by customizing the method. Put another way, as opposed to make every person submit bank statements, credit history an such like right from the start, it crunches available information and approves individuals with good credit immediately. It just requests more details away from you if concerns arise, approving or rejecting when it’s sufficient information which will make the best choice.
Co-founders Jacob Rosenberg and Sasha Orloff inform us that they’re able to construct a powerful application that alterations in realtime predicated on consumer danger pages and portion with an increased degree of precision with the use of data sources that many banking institutions or credit bureaus don’t consider. The startup is taking its formula one stop further, offering instant online loans with its foundations in place, today. Which means LendUp now is able to deposit money into your account in less than fifteen minutes, to ensure consumers not only will make an application for to get authorized faster than than they generally would, however they currently have near-instant use of that loan.
LendUp loans are available on mobile, therefore unlike its aforementioned lending rivals, LendUp deposits that money in your banking account, which you can then access from your own laptop computer or while you’re on-the-go.
Orloff, who has got almost 15 years of expertise doing work in credit analysis at the World Bank, Citigroup as well as others, states that the biggest issue inherent to the present financing procedure is the fact that it will take as much as four times if you have good credit become authorized for loans.
If you want cash straight away as a result of impending deadlines, whenever it is an emergency, that is too much time to wait patiently.
The founders believe that they’re removing one of the last advantages of going to a payday loan store rather than borrowing online by depositing loans directly into your bank account and making that capital available while you’re on the go. Participating banks provide instant direct deposits and loan choices through LendUp, while users with non-participating bank reports will get loans the next working day.
It hopes to incentive users by providing monetary training through its “LendUp Ladder,” which aims to assist borrowers with woeful credit enhance their credit ratings by utilizing LendUp to pay for their loans on time.
Featuring its brand new statement today, LendUp is eliminating one of the final obstacles that stands when it comes to short-term, payday lending which actually offers reasonable terms towards the customer.
